3.5 rounded to 4

I really got into this book fast. It's definitely an attention grabber and a very quick read.

However that being said, the last few chapters left much to be desired IMHO. I was hyped up, expecting an outrageous ending due to how the story was written so far. Don't get me wrong, the ending is good it's just, to me, some parts are too far fetched.

There were also parts throughout the story that, while meant to sway and lead away from the true ending, were just left there without closure and seemed unnecessarily added. I understand wanting to confuse the reader as to the killer's identity but then go back and close the circle.

Maybe that will show up in the sequel?
